How should education systems reinvent themselves to foster not just subject matter expertise but also emotional intelligence and societal empathy?

ANSWER: Education systems must integrate social-emotional learning (SEL) into curricula, emphasizing collaboration, communication, and empathy. They should adopt multidisciplinary, project-based approaches that encourage real-world problem-solving and community interaction. Smaller class sizes and training educators in SEL methods will also nurture emotional intelligence and societal empathy alongside academic excellence.
